NWE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2017 in Review

243 of the 4,017 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in NorthWestern Energy (NWE) for Q1 2017, worth a combined $2.76B — up 2.4% from $2.69B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 31 funds opened new NWE positions and 24 closed out — a net gain of 7 holders — while 102 added to existing stakes and 76 trimmed.

The largest buyer was BlackRock, adding an estimated $524M. The largest seller was Deutsche Bank, cutting an estimated $143M.
